UK. Currently the University provide up to 35 scholarships for New taught Master’s students on all full-time courses. These will be an academic merit based awards with about £3,000 value for courses with fees over £10,000 and £2,000 value for other courses.Tenure for the awards would be one year.
Candidates for Open Scholarships must be classified by the University as international students for fees purposes. Except in the case of Open PhD Scholarships, all Open Scholarships are awarded only in the form of a reduction in tuition fees payable.
For Open PhD Scholarships, candidates must not be in receipt of a full scholarship (tuition fees and living costs) from any other sources. Students with partial scholarships from other sources will be considered. For Open Master’s and Undergraduate Scholarships, students must be self-funded.
Where an Open Scholarship is awarded to a candidate who is also eligible for a fee discount, the discount will be calculated after the Scholarships reduction to the tuition fees payable has been made. Some scholarship funding may also be available to outstanding PhD students who begin their studies at other points in the academic year.
